of the Council of Maryland, 1778-1779. 277


Saturday 9 January 1779

Present as on yesterday
William Geddes Naval Officer of the eighth District resigns
his Commission
Commission of Letter of Marque & Reprisal issued to
Aquila Johns, Commander of the Ship Buckskin, 200 Tons
burthen, mounting 28 Carriage Guns, and 24 small Arms,
belonging to Samuel and Robert Purviance; John Crockett &
others of Baltimore

Monday n January 1779

Present as on Saturday
Commission of Letter of Marque & Reprisal issued to
Ignatius Fenwick Commander of the Brigantine Sally 90 Tons
burthen, mounting 10 Carriage Guns, 4 Swivels and 15 small
Arms, belonging to Archibald Buchanan, Daniel Bowley,
William Hammond & others of Baltimore
Ordered that the western shore Treasurer pay to William
Hyde sixty five Pounds Eighteen Shillings & six Pence half
Penny due him for his Attendance as Assistant Cl. to the
Governor & Council due the 5 Instant

C. B.

[Council to Judges.]

In Council Annapolis 11th Jany 1779
Sir.
The General Assembly having appointed yourself, Benjamin
Mackall the 4th Thomas Jones, Solomon Wright and James
Murray, Judges of the Court of Appeals, the Commission is
accordingly issued, of which we think proper to give you
this Information
We are &ca
Benja Rumsey & others
Judges of the Court of Appeals

C. C.

Tuesday, 12 January 1779

Present as on yesterday except James Hindman Esqr
Ordered that the Western Shore Treasurer pay to Allen
Quynn Forty five Pounds due him per Account passed by the
Prinl Cl. to the Aud. Genl

C. B.
